Process Improvement Developer
Mobis Parts Canada Corporation
Location
Markham, ON | Canada
Job description
MOBIS Parts Canada ("MPCA") is a technological leader in the automotive industry focusing on the distribution of parts for Hyundai Motor Company and Kia Motors. Through collaboration, ingenuity and a promise to provide safety and happiness to our customers, we are committed to constant evolution and the development of a variety of cutting edge technologies.
In approximately 40 countries worldwide, headquartered in Seoul, Korea, we have expanded our presence in Canada. Globally, MOBIS encourages individuals to take on new challenges and drive innovation. We strive to maintain a global competitive edge, based on product quality and customer value.
Our vision is to secure a Global Top 5 lifetime partner position in the marketplace. In 2016, MPCA transitioned to a newly built 550,000 sq. ft. facility located in Markham, ON (Canada). You will be joining us at a very exciting time as we build the foundation for our future.
POSITION SUMMARY
The Process Improvement Developer acts as the technical lead for multi departmental projects creating solutions that meet market needs. Responsible for designing fully functioning, debugged code with required documentation that meets development goals. This individual will conduct cycle time analysis and other system audits to verify current production rates and target potential improvements, as well as investigate procedural improvements.
KEY ACCOUNTABILITIES
- Design, code, and test major features in collaboration with Team Members, and technical team to deliver complex changes.
- Define, design, and implement, multi-tiered object-oriented distributed software applications.
- Maintain and modify existing applications.
- Perform maintenance programming for existing version.
- Perform custom programming as assigned.
- Fix defects and add features to software.
- Debug and test software implementation.
- Provide, design documents and documentation to ensure efficient maintenance and code reuse.
- Participate in the design and implementation of databases.
- Ensure the functionality, performance, scalability, reliability, realistic implementation schedules and system architecture for each assignment.
- Analyze, define, and improve various processes in office and warehouse environment
- Maintain and modify our database management and analysis.
- Develop business intelligence programs and processes.
- Interact with key partners and internal users regarding timelines, technical issues, and infrastructure integration.
- Provide recommendations for improvements in the overall development process.
- Implement software modules, on the embedded platform and analysis workstation.
- Stay current with trends, techniques, technology and other factors impacting the job.
- Actively participate in team meetings and offer recommendations /ideas on design projects.
CORE COMPETENCIES
- SOP auditing and writing
- Analytical skills
- Data Analyst/analytical
- Excellent communication skills
- SQL
- Python
- Visual Basic Application
- Visio
- Power BI
- Microsoft Excel
- Microsoft project
REQUIRED COMPETENCIES
- Bachelor's degree or College Diploma in Computer Science or equivalent job experience.
- Minimum three 3 years' experience as Database Developer
- Minimum of 3 years' experience in a development role.
- Minimum 2 years' experience in requirements analysis, design, coding and unit testing of scalable, distributed, fault-tolerant applications in Operating Systems.
- Work experience in object-oriented design methodology and application development in JAVA and J2EE, including Servlets, JSP, JAVA Beans, JDBC preferred.
- Work experience with C/C++ preferred.
- Work experience in XML preferred.
- An understanding of the hardware-software boundary.
- Able to effectively communicate technical concepts to other technical staff members.
- Able to effectively communicate with non-technical members of the organization.
- Demonstrated aptitude for learning new technologies.
- Effective written and verbal communication skills as well as presentation skills.
- Excellent teamwork and team building skills.
- Able to work well under pressure and meet set deadlines.
- Superior time management skills, multitasking skills, and the ability to prioritize tasks with minimal supervision.
- Ability to follow through and complete overlapping projects.
- High level of critical and logical thinking, analysis, and/or reasoning to identify underlying principles, reasons, or facts.
Job tags
Salary
$60k - $65k per year